About Christopher Hope's earlier volume of poems Cape Drives the T.L.S. wrote: 'Their verbal burliness is controlled by a taut emotional discipline which allows for moments of metaphorical brio or clinching wit, heightening without overcolouring their tenacious social realism... their emotional tight-lippedness is not to be mistaken for neutrality, but seems rather the necessary stringency of a poet who needs to feel his way back into an increasingly alien world by a process of precise observation, clarifying and defining its textures so that perception itself becomes a kind of moral act.'

Many of the poems in this new book have, like those in its predecessor, South African subjects; even those that do not are often tinged by the experience of having seen racialism close up. The main difference from Cape Drives, though, is that all these new poems were written in England. Their themes correspondingly vary, but in all of them there is evidence of the terse wit and social awareness that distinguish all Christopher Hope's writing.
